May 2012 report[edit source | editbeta]

In May 2012, the IAEA reported that Iran had increased its rate of production of low-enriched uranium enriched to 3.5% and to expand its stockpile of uranium enriched to 19.75%, but was having difficulty with more advanced centrifuges.[20Sony PCG-81114L Battery

Sony PCG-81214L Battery7] The IAEA also reported detecting particles of uranium enriched to 27% at the Fordu enrichment facility. However, a diplomat in Vienna cautioned that the spike in uranium purity found by inspectors could turn out to be accidental.[208] Sony SVE1511A1EW battery

Sony SVE1713S1E battery This change drastically moved Iran's uranium toward bomb-grade material. Until now, the highest level of purity that had been found in Iran was 20 percent.[209]

In late August, the IAEA set up an Iran Task Force to deal with inspections and other issues related to Iran's nuclear program, in an attempt to focus and streamline the IAEA's handling of Iran's nuclear program by concentrating experts and other resources into one dedicated team.[210] Sony SVE1511L1E battery

Sony SVE1713C5E battery

On 30 August, the IAEA released a report showing a major expansion of Iranian enrichment activities. The report said that Iran has more than doubled the number of centrifuges at the underground facility at Fordow, from 1,064 centrifuges in May to 2,140 centrifuges in August,
Sony SVE1712Z1E batterythough the number of operating centrifuges had not increased. The report said that since 2010 Iran had produced about 190 kg of 20%-enriched uranium, up from 145 kg in May. The report also noted that Iran had converted some of the 20%-enriched uranium to an oxide form and fabricated into fuel for use in research reactors, Sony SVE1511M1E battery

Sony SVE1711X1E battery
Sony SVE1712Q1E batteryand that once this conversion and fabrication have taken place, the fuel cannot be readily enriched to weapon-grade purity.[211][212]

The report also expressed concerns over Parchin, which the IAEA has sought to inspect for evidence of nuclear weapons development. Since the IAEA requested access, "significant ground scraping and landscaping have been undertaken over an extensive area at and around the location," Sony SVE1511P1E battery

Sony SVE1711F1E battery five buildings had been demolished, while power lines, fences, and paved roads were removed, all of which would hamper the IAEA investigation if it were granted access.[213]

November 2012 report[edit source | editbeta]

On 16 November, the IAEA released a report showing continued expansion in Iranian uranium enrichment capabilities. At Fordow, all 2784 IR-1 centrifuges (16 cascades of 174 each) have been installed, Sony SVE1512K1E battery
Sony SVE1512M1E battery though only 4 cascades are operating and another 4 are fully equipped, vacuum-tested, and ready to begin operating.[219] Iran has produced approximately 233 kg of near-20% enriched uranium, an increase of 43 kg since the August 2012 IAEA report.[220] Sony SVE1511A1EB battery

 

The IAEA August 2012 report stated that Iran had begun to use 96 kg of its near-20% enriched uranium to fabricate fuel for the Tehran Research Reactor, which makes it more difficult to further enrich that uranium to weapons grade, since it would first need to be converted back to uranium hexafluoride gas.[22Sony SVE14A1S1EB battery

Sony SVE17 battery 1] Though more of this uranium has been fabricated into fuel, no additional uranium has been sent to the Fuel Plate Fabrication Plant at Esfahan.[219]

The November report noted that Iran has continued to deny the IAEA access to the military site at Parchin. Citing evidence from satellite imagery that "Iran constructed a large explosives containment vessel in which to conduct hydrodynamic experiments" relevant to nuclear weapons development, Sony SVE14A1S1EP battery

Sony SVE1713Z1E batterythe report expresses concern that changes taking place at the Parchin military site might eliminate evidence of past nuclear activities, noting that there had been virtually no activity at that location between February 2005 and the time the IAEA requested access. Those changes include: Sony SVE1511Q1EB battery

Sony SVE1513V1E battery

Frequent presence of equipment, trucks and personnel.

Large amounts of liquid run-off.

Removal of external pipework.

Razing and removal of five other buildings or structures and the site perimeter fence.

Reconfiguration of electrical and water supply.

Shrouding of the containment vessel building.

Scraping and removal of large quantities of earth and the depositing of new earth in its place.[219][222] Sony SVE1511R9ESI battery
 

Iran said that the IR-40 heavy water-moderated research reactor at Arak was expected begin to operate in the first quarter of 2014. During on-site inspections of the IR-40 design, IAEA inspectors observed that the installation of cooling and moderator circuit piping was continuing.[222] Sony SVE1511V1EW battery

February 2013 report[edit source | editbeta]

On 21 February, the IAEA released a report showing continued expansion in Iranian uranium enrichment capabilities. As of 19 February, 12,699 IR-1 centrifuges have been installed at Natanz. This includes the installation of 2,255 centrifuges since the previous IAEA report in November.[223] Sony SVE1511W1ESI battery
Sony SVE14 battery
 

Fordow, the nuclear facility near Qom, contains 16 cascades, equally divided between Unit 1 and Unit 2, with a total of 2,710 centrifuges. Iran is continuing to operate the four cascades of 174 IR-1 centrifuges each in two tandem sets to produce 19.75% LEU in a total of 696 enriching centrifuges, the same number of centrifuges enriching as was reported in November 2012.[22
Sony SVE1513B4E battery4]

Iran has produced approximately 280 kg of near-20% enriched uranium, an increase of 47 kg since the November 2012 IAEA report and the total 3.5% LEU production stands at 8,271 kg (compared to 7,611 kg reported during the last quarter).[223] Sony SVE14A1S1E battery
Sony SVE14A3C5E battery

Sony SVE1513B1E battery

The IAEA February 2013 report stated that Iran has resumed reconverting near-20% enriched uranium into Oxide form to fabricate fuel for the Tehran Research Reactor, which makes it more difficult to further enrich that uranium to weapons grade, since it would first need to be converted back to uranium hexafluoride gas.[225] Sony SVE15 battery

Laptop and Research & Development in nuclear weapons[edit source | editbeta]

 

The continuing controversy over Iran's nuclear program revolves in part around allegations of nuclear studies by Iran with possible military applications until 2003, when, according to the 2007 National Intelligence Estimate, the program was ended. Dell Latitude E6510 battery

Dell Latitude E5220 batteryThe allegations, which include claims that Iran had engaged in high-explosives testing, sought to manufacture "green salt" (UF

4) and to design a nuclear-capable missile warhead, were based on information obtained from a laptop computer which was allegedly retrieved from Iran in 2004.[3Dell Latitude E6120 battery

Dell Latitude E6430s battery48] The US presented some of the alleged contents of the laptop in 2005 to an audience of international diplomats, though the laptop and the full documents contained in it have yet to be given to the IAEA for independent verification. According to the New York Times:
Dell Latitude E6430 battery

“     Nonetheless, doubts about the intelligence persist among some foreign analysts. In part, that is because American officials, citing the need to protect their source, have largely refused to provide details of the origins of the laptop computer beyond saying that they obtained it in mid-2004 from a longtime contact in Iran. Dell Latitude E6210 battery

Dell Latitude E6330 batteryMoreover, this chapter in the confrontation with Iran is infused with the memory of the faulty intelligence on Iraq's unconventional arms. In this atmosphere, though few countries are willing to believe Iran's denials about nuclear arms, few are willing to accept the United States' weapons intelligence without question. Dell Latitude E6220 battery
"I can fabricate that data," a senior European diplomat said of the documents. "It looks beautiful, but is open to doubt.[349]          ”

On 21 August 2007, Iran and the IAEA finalized an agreement, titled "Understandings of The Islamic Republic of Iran and the IAEA on the Modalities of Resolution of the Outstanding Issues," that listed outstanding issues regarding Iran's nuclear program and set out a timetable to resolve each issue in order.
Dell Latitude E6320 batteryThese unresolved issues included the status of Iran's uranium mine at Gchine, allegations of experiments with plutonium and uranium metal, and the use of Polonium 210.[350] Specifically regarding the "Alleged Studies", the Modalities agreement asserted that while Iran considers the documents to be fabricated, Dell Latitude E6230 battery Iran would nevertheless address the allegations "upon receiving all related documents" as a goodwill gesture. The Modalities Agreement specifically said that aside from the issues identified in the document, there were "no other remaining issues and ambiguities regarding Iran's past nuclear program and activities." Following the implementation of the Modalities Agreement, the IAEA issued another report on the status of Iran's nuclear program on 22 February 2008. According to this report, the IAEA had no evidence of a current, Sony PCG-6Z4M battery

 

Sony VPCZ21X9R battery undeclared nuclear program in Iran, and all of the remaining issues listed in the Modalities Agreement regarding past undeclared nuclear activities had been resolved, with the exception of the "Alleged Studies" issue. Regarding this report, IAEA director ElBaradei specifically stated: Sony PCG-6112M battery

 

Sony VPCZ21V9E battery

“     [W]e have made quite good progress in clarifying the outstanding issues that had to do with Iran's past nuclear activities, with the exception of one issue, and that is the alleged weaponization studies that supposedly Iran has conducted in the past. We have managed to clarify all the remaining outstanding issues, including the most important issue, which is the scope and nature of Iran's enrichment programmeSony PCG-6121M battery

 

Sony VPCZ12Z9E/X battery.[352]  ”

The US had made some of the "Alleged Studies" documentation available to the IAEA just a week prior to the issuance of the IAEA's February 2008 report on Iran's nuclear program. According to the IAEA report itself, the IAEA had "not detected the use of nuclear material in connection with the alleged studies, Sony PCG-6122M battery

Sony PCG-6123M battery

nor does it have credible information in this regard." Some diplomats reportedly dismissed the new allegations as being "of doubtful value ... relatively insignificant and coming too late."[353]

It was reported on 3 March 2008, that Olli Heinonen, the IAEA Deputy Director general of safeguards, had briefed diplomats about the contents of the "Alleged Studies" documents a week earlier. Reportedly, Sony PCG-6124M battery

 

Sony VPCZ12Z9E/B battery Heinonen added that the IAEA had obtained corroborating information from the intelligence agencies of several countries, that pointed to sophisticated research into some key technologies needed to build and deliver a nuclear bomb.[354]

In April 2008, Iran reportedly agreed to address the sole outstanding issue of the "Alleged Studies"[355] Sony VPCZ13 battery

 

Sony VPCZ12X9E/B batteryHowever, according to the subsequent May 2008 IAEA report, the IAEA was not able to actually provide these same "Alleged Studies" documents to Iran, because the IAEA did not have the documents itself or was not allowed to share them with Iran. For example, in paragraph 21, the IAEA report states: "Although the Agency had been shown the documents that led it to these conclusions, Sony VPCZ13M9E/B battery

 

Sony VPCZ12V9E/B battery it was not in possession of the documents and was therefore unfortunately unable to make them available to Iran." Also, in paragraph 16, the IAEA report states: "The Agency received much of this information only in electronic form and was not authorised to provide copies to Iran." Sony VPCZ13V9E battery

 

Sony VPCZ12V9E batteryThe IAEA has requested that it be allowed to share the documents with Iran. Nevertheless, according the report, Iran may have more information on the alleged studies which "remain a matter of serious concern" but the IAEA itself had not detected evidence of actual design or manufacture by Iran of nuclear weapons or components. Sony VPCZ13Z9E/X battery

Sony VPCZ21Q9E battery

 

Iran's refusal to respond to the IAEA's questions unless it is given access to the original documents has caused a standoff. In February 2008, the New York Times reported that the U.S. refusal to provide access to those documents was a source of friction between the Bush Administration and then Director General ElBaradei.[35Sony VPCZ23K9E battery

 

Sony VPCZ12M9E/B battery6] ElBaradei later noted that these documents could not be shared because of the need to protect sources and methods, but noted that this allowed Iran to question their authenticity.[357] Sony VGP-BPL20 battery

 

Sony VPCZ12M9E battery According to Iran's envoy to the IAEA, Ali Asghar Soltanieh, "The government of the United States has not handed over original documents to the agency since it does not in fact have any authenticated document and all it has are forged documents."[358] Sony VGP-BPS20/B battery

 

Sony VPCZ12C7E/B battery

The IAEA has requested that third-parties[vague] allow it to share the documents on the alleged studies with Iran. The IAEA has further stated that though it has not provided full documents containing the alleged studies, information from other countries has corroborated some of the allegations, which appear to the IAEA to be consistent and credible, Sony VGP-BPS20/S battery

Sony VPCZ11 battery

 

Sony VPCZ11Z9E/B battery and that Iran should therefore address the alleged studies even without obtaining the full documents. However, questions about the authenticity of the documents persist, with claims that the documents were obtained either from Israel or the MEK, an Iranian dissident group officially considered to be a terrorist organization by the United States,

 

Sony VPCZ11Z9E batteryand that investigations into the alleged studies are intended to reveal intelligence about Iran's conventional weapons programs.[359][360][361][362] Some IAEA officials have requested a clear statement be made by the agency that it could not affirm the documents' authenticity.

Sony VPCZ11X9E/B batteryThey cite that as a key document in the study had since been proven to have been fraudulently altered, it put in doubt the entire collection.[363]

Iran's nuclear program and the NPT[edit source | editbeta]

Main article: Nuclear Non-Proliferation Treaty

Iran says that its program is solely for peaceful purposes and consistent with the NPT.[364] The IAEA Board of Governors has found Iran in non-compliance with its NPT safeguards agreement, concluding in a rare non-consensus decision with 12 abstentions,[365 Sony VPCZ11X9E battery] that Iran's past safeguards "breaches" and "failures" constituted "non-compliance" with its Safeguards Agreement[105][366] In the decision, the IAEA Board of Governors also concluded that the concerns raised fell within the competence of the UN Security Council.[105] Sony VGN-TT1RLN/B battery

Sony VGN-TT1RVN/X battery

 

Most experts recognize that non-compliance with an NPT safeguards agreement is not equivalent to a violation of the NPT or does not automatically constitute a violation of the NPT itself.[367][368Sony VGN-TT1RWN/X battery

 

Sony VGN-Z21 battery

] The IAEA does not make determinations regarding compliance with the NPT,[369] and the UN Security Council does not have a responsibility to adjudicate treaty violations.[370] Dr. James Acton, an associate in the Nonproliferation Program at the Carnegie Endowment for International Peace, has said the 2010 NPT Review Conference could recognize that non-compliance with safeguards agreements would violate article III of the NPT.[371Sony VGN-TT11LN/B battery

 

Sony VGN-Z11XN/X battery Director of the Australian Nonproliferation and Safeguards Organization and then Chairman of IAEA Standing Advisory Group on Safeguards Implementation[372] John Carlson wrote in considering the case of Iran that "formally IAEA Board of Governors (BOG) decisions concern compliance with safeguards agreements, Sony VGN-TT11M/N battery

Sony VGN-TT11RM/N battery

rather than the NPT as such, but in practical terms non-compliance with a safeguards agreement constitutes non-compliance with the NPT."[373]

A September 2009 Congressional Research Service paper said "whether Iran has violated the NPT is unclear."[374Sony VGN-TT11RM/R battery

 

Sony VGN-Z11WN/B battery] A 2005 U.S. State Department report on compliance with arms control and nonproliferation agreements concluded, based on its analysis of the facts and the relevant international laws, that Iran's extensive failures to make required reports to the IAEA made "clear that Iran has violated Article III of the NPT and its IAEA safeguards agreement."[369Sony VGN-TT11VN/X battery

 

Sony VGN-Z11MN/B battery] Testimony presented to the Foreign Select Committee of the British Parliament drew the opposite conclusion:

“     The enforcement of Article III of the NPT obligations is carried out through the IAEA's monitoring and verification that is designed to ensure that declared nuclear facilities are operated according to safeguard agreement with Iran, which Iran signed with the IAEA in 1974.

 

Sony VGP-BPS14/B battery

Sony VGP-BPS14/S battery In the past four years that Iran's nuclear programme has been under close investigation by the IAEA, the Director General of the IAEA, as early as November 2003 reported to the IAEA Board of Governors that "to date, there is no evidence that the previously undeclared nuclear material and activities ... were related to a nuclear weapons programme." .

 

Sony VGP-BPS14 battery.. Although Iran has been found in non-compliance with some aspects of its IAEA safeguards obligations, Iran has not been in breach of its obligations under the terms of the NPT.[375]  ”

 

Sony VGP-BPL14/S battery

The 2005 U.S. State Department compliance report also concluded that "Iran is pursuing an effort to manufacture nuclear weapons, and has sought and received assistance in this effort in violation of Article II of the NPT".[369Sony VGN-TT11WN/B battery

 

Sony VGP-BPL14/B battery] The November 2007 United States National Intelligence Estimate (NIE) asserted that Tehran halted a nuclear weapons program in fall 2003, but that Iran "at a minimum is keeping open the option to develop nuclear weapon".[156] Sony VGN-TT11XN/B battery

Sony VGN-TT21JN/B battery

 

Sony VGP-BPL14 batteryRussian analyst Alexei Arbatov, said "no hard facts on violation of the NPT per se have been discovered" and also wrote that "all this is not enough to accuse Iran of a formal breach of the letter of the NPT" and "giving Iran the benefit of the doubt, there is no hard evidence of its full-steam development of a military nuclear program."[376] Sony VGN-TT21VN/X battery

 

Sony VGN-TT battery

NPT Article IV recognizes the right of states to research, develop and use nuclear energy for peaceful purposes, but only in conformity with their nuclear nonproliferation obligations under Articles I and II of the NPT. Sony VGN-TT21WN/B battery

Sony VGN-TT46GG/W battery

 

The UN Security Council has demanded that Iran suspend its nuclear enrichment activities in multiple resolutions.[377][378] The United States has said the "central bargain of the NPT is that if non-nuclear-weapon states renounce the pursuit of nuclear weapons, and comply fully with this commitment, they may gain assistance under Article IV of the Treaty to develop peaceful nuclear programs". Sony VGN-TT46MG/W battery

Sony VGN-TT46SG/W batteryThe U.S. has written that Paragraph 1 of Article IV makes clear that access to peaceful nuclear cooperation must be "in conformity with Articles I and II of this Treaty" and also by extension Article III of the NPT.[3Sony VGN-Z21MN/B battery

 

Sony VGN-Z11VN/X battery79] Rahman Bonad, Director of Arms Control Studies at the Center for Strategic Research at Tehran, has argued that demands to cease enrichment run counter to "all negotiations and discussions that led to the adoption of the NPT in the 1960s and the fundamental logic of striking a balance between the rights and obligations stipulated in the NPT."[38Sony VGN-Z21WN/B battery

 

Sony VGN-Z51XG/B battery0] In February 2006 Iran's foreign minister insisted that "Iran rejects all forms of scientific and nuclear apartheid by any world power," and asserted that this "scientific and nuclear apartheid" was "an immoral and discriminatory treatment of signatories to the Non-Proliferation Treaty,"[3Sony VGN-Z21XN battery

 

Sony VGN-Z51WG/B battery81] and that Iran has "the right to a peaceful use of nuclear energy and we cannot accept nuclear apartheid."[382]
